Stealth and survivability features
Stealth and survivability features are critical components that enhance the effectiveness of strategic bombers in modern air campaigns. These features aim to reduce the likelihood of detection and increase the aircraft’s ability to operate in contested environments.
Key elements of stealth capabilities include radar-absorbing materials and design modifications that minimize radar cross-section, making bombers less visible to enemy radar systems. This technological advancement allows strategic bombers to penetrate sophisticated air defenses with greater success.
In addition, survivability is bolstered through electronic countermeasures, such as radar jamming and decoys, which disrupt enemy tracking systems. Advanced sensors and phased-array radars also improve situational awareness, enabling quicker response to threats.
A few notable features include:
- Radar-absorbing coatings and shapes designed for reduced radar signature.
- Electronic warfare systems that jam or deceive enemy radar and missile systems.
- Low-flight profiles and terrain masking techniques to evade detection.
These stealth and survivability features collectively extend the operational lifespan of strategic bombers in hostile territories, ensuring mission success while mitigating risks.

Case Studies: Notable Air Campaigns Utilizing Strategic Bombers
Historical air campaigns exemplify the strategic importance of strategic bombers. In World War II, the Allied bombing of German industrial centers showcased the ability to systematically weaken enemy infrastructure from long range. These missions highlighted the operational capabilities of bombers like the B-17 Flying Fortress and the British Wellington.
The Cold War era further demonstrated their significance, particularly with the U.S. Strategic Air Command’s emphasis on nuclear deterrence. Notably, the 1991 Gulf War saw the deployment of B-52 Stratofortresses to target Iraqi military infrastructure, illustrating their sustained precision strike ability within modern air campaigns.
Recent conflicts have also relied on strategic bombers for targeted precision strikes. For example, in Afghanistan and Syria, B-1 and B-2 aircraft have executed high-precision conventional missions, combining technological advancements with strategic objectives. These case studies emphasize the continuing vital role of strategic bombers in shaping modern air campaigns and global security strategies.
